Nigeria, Sept. 17 -- Oxfam in Nigeria and the Civil Society Legislative Advocacy Centre (CISLAC) have held strategic talks with the Economic Community of West African States (ECOWAS) Commission, seeking to broaden collaboration on some of the region's most pressing challenges, ranging from widening inequality and climate justice to security and integration.
The meeting, hosted by ECOWAS Commission President Omar Touray, brought together senior representatives from the two civil society organisations.
